Does parenchyma regenerate?
Abstract. After liver injury, parenchymal regeneration occurs through hepatocyte replication. However, during regenerative stress, oval cells (OCs) and small hepatocyte like progenitor cells (SHPCs) contribute to the process.

How are stromal and parenchymal repair of a tissue different?
Parenchyma / Stroma: The parenchyma of an organ consists of that tissue which conducts the specific function of the organ and which usually comprises the bulk of the organ. Stroma is everything else — connective tissue, blood vessels, nerves, ducts.

Where are parenchyma cells?
Parenchyma cells occur in the form of continuous masses as homogeneous parenchyma tissues e.g. in pith and cortex of stems and roots, mesophyll of leaves, the flesh of succulent fruits and in the endosperm of seeds.
What is meant by tissue repair?
Tissue repair is defined as the restoration of tissue architecture and function following an injury. In toxicant-induced injury, tissue repair plays a primary role in determining whether the patient will recover from injury, or whether the injury will progress and lead to death.

What is the difference between repair and regeneration?
When talking of wound healing, a distinction is made between regeneration and repair. Regeneration is used to refer to the complete replacement of damaged tissue with new tissue not associated with scar tissue, while repair is used to refer to the reestablishment of tissue continuity.

Can parenchymal cells be repaired by regeneration?
If an injury damages only parenchymal cells in a continuously-dividing or quiescent tissue, repair by regeneration is possible.
